Transaction 58904e7adc7838a79f7b83380476d23fe60f15f792241ee2768ee2dd5faaa4f1
1 Input
2 Outputs
- 58904e7adc7838a79f7b83380476d23fe60f15f792241ee2768ee2dd5faaa4f1:0
- 58904e7adc7838a79f7b83380476d23fe60f15f792241ee2768ee2dd5faaa4f1:1
value 176500
address 1GC5ye2DCWDcMzUG5q9zbffADxMSoPxvoV
value 6553886
address 15paLfvGNx5RueDnfrEFghKPEk9E6A44EE